Core Natural Resources, Inc.
A major North American coal producer, formed in January 2025 through a "merger of equals" between two long-time rivals, CONSOL Energy and Arch Resources. It mines both metallurgical coal for steelmaking and thermal coal for power generation, running longwall mines in Pennsylvania and operations in Appalachia. Its roots run deep: CONSOL traces back to the Consolidation Coal Company, founded in 1860 when western Maryland operators joined together to "consolidate" their holdings.

A Form 4 reports a holding per line — held directly, or through a named trust, partnership or foundation, and in each share class separately — never a person’s total. Lines not restated in that time are left out and shown apart: an active filer restates what they still hold, so a line they did not restate is more often an entity since renamed, whose shares a successor line reports too.
